Taman Seroja Indah, Kuala Muda, Kedah
Taman Seroja Indah in Kuala Muda, Kedah recorded 4 Low-Cost House properties sub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, with a median price of RM148K and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M134.
This area consists exclusively of residential properties, with no commercial listings recorded.
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M148K,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M130K to RM165K, and a typical market range of RM136K to RM160K.
Within the Low-Cost House category, 1 - 1 1/2 storey terraced dominated the market, though some variety exists in the market.
The median PSF stands at RM134, with core pricing between RM119 and RM150. Market pricing typically extends from RM124.34 to RM144.34, reflecting moderate variation in unit pricing. With an IQR of RM20.00 and MAD of RM16, the PSF demonstrates reasonable consistency across the market.
